Kenyan Officers Join Regional Training At Ilea Gaborone, to Combat Human Trafficking

Nairobi — Special Agents from United States Homeland Security Investigations (HSI) are training law enforcement officers from Kenya this week to combat trafficking in persons at the International Law Enforcement Academy (ILEA) in Otse, Botswana.

The US Embassy in Nairobi said that the five officers are drawn from anti-human trafficking, child protection unit, and the economic crimes unit in the DCI.
